Studies On The Chemical Constituents And Bioactivities From The Fruits Of Garcinia Bracteata

Garcinia bracteata,a Guttiferae Garcinia plant,which ripe fruits can be eaten raw and processed into spices,mainly distributed in southern Yunnan to southern Guangxi.It has been reported that compounds,such as xanthones and biphenyl derivatives,isolated from stems,branches and leaves of G.bracteata,and showed different degrees of inhibition on tumor cells.In order to exploit the resources of Garcinia plant better,we launched a systematic study to investigate the chemical constituents and pharmacological of G.bracteata.By means of a variety of modern chromatographic separation techniques,24compounds?1-24?,including 15 xanthones?1-15?and 9 polycyclic polyprenylated phloroglucinols?PPAPs??16-24?,were isolated from the ethyl acetate extraction of G.bracteata.Among them,9 compounds?4-6,11,18-19,21-23?are determined as new compounds.Compounds 4-6 are new pernylated xanthones,compound 11 is a new caged polyprenylated xanthones,compounds 18-19,21-23 are new PPAPs.Garcibracteamone H?22?and Garcibracteamone I?23?posses an unprecedented caged 5-oxatetracyclo-[7.4.1.19,12.03,7]pentadecane new skeleton.Anti-tumor activities of isolated compounds were tested by CCK-8 method aganist T98,HepG2,and MCF-7.Most of the caged polyprenylated xanthones compounds showed different degrees of inhibition on tumor cells.Among them,compound 8?Doitunggarcinone K?and 14?Neobractatin?showed good anticancer activity,and showed strong activity against the tested three tumor cells,with IC50values of 3.47?M,5.51?M,5.87?M and 3.21?M,5.11?M,6.27?M,respectively.In addition,compounds 7,9,10,13 also showed moderate cytotoxic activity.The LPS-induced mouse mononuclear macrophage leukemia cell RAW264.7cells were used to establish an inflammatory model.The Griess method was used to study the effect of the compounds,which were isolated from the G.bracteata fruit,on the release of NO from RAW264.7.Most of the caged polyprenylated xanthones isolated from fruits showed good anti-inflammatory activity,among which compound2?5-O-methylxanthone?,compound 3?10-O-methylmacluraxanthone?,compound 7?Bractatin?,Compound9?Isobractatin?,compound12?8?-methoxy-8,8a?-dihydrobractatin?,Compound 15?Neobractatin?have a good inhibitory effect on NO release from RAW 264.7 with IC50 values of 14.19?M,16.39?M,1.22?M,6.07?M,8.96?M,1.77?M,respectively.Those results showed that the fruits of G.bracteata contain many compounds with structural diversities,and most of the caged polyprenylated xanthones exhibit good anti-inflammatory and anti-tumor activities.It indicates that G.bracteata can be further researched in the development of new anti-tumor and anti-inflammatory drugs.
